Technological Innovation And Development Trends Of Waste Paper Hydraulic Baler Machine

With technological advancements and increasingly stringent environmental requirements, Waste Paper Hydraulic Baler Machine technology is constantly innovating and upgrading. Currently, intelligent and energy-saving technologies have become the main directions for equipment development. Many users, when evaluating equipment, not only ask about the price of a waste paper baler but also focus on its technological sophistication and future development potential.
Modern waste paper balers, based on traditional hydraulic systems, incorporate intelligent elements such as PLC control systems and human-machine interfaces. Operators can easily set various parameters and monitor the equipment’s operating status in real time via a touchscreen. Some high-end models are also equipped with remote monitoring capabilities, allowing users to access equipment operating data in real time via a mobile app for preventative maintenance. In terms of energy saving, new waste paper balers utilize variable pump technology and energy recovery systems, achieving energy savings of over 30% compared to traditional equipment.
Improved environmental performance has also been a significant development trend in recent years. The equipment has been optimized in terms of noise control and oil leakage protection, better meeting modern environmental requirements. Furthermore, the introduction of modular design makes equipment maintenance more convenient, significantly reducing downtime for repairs.
